3. I've never heard of a "Focus
Group" ... what in the world is that?
A "Focus Group" is a group of individuals selected
and assembled by researchers to discuss and
comment on, from personal experience, the topic
that is the subject of the research. Just like
surveys, you simply share your opinions and
discuss them with others.
Focus groups are often held online via special
communication or chat systems, but they also
take place in the "real" world as well. If you
are interested in participating in these types
of focus groups, we show you how - and you can
often earn up to $150 per hour for doing so!

6. What about taxes on the money
I make ... how does that work?
If you're a U.S. citizen, you'll be considered
an "independent contractor" for income tax
purposes, and no income or other taxes are
withheld from the payments you receive.
Any company that pays you over $600 in a calender
year is required to send you a Form 1099,
and you're supposed to include this as "miscellaneous
income" on your tax return.
If you are not a U.S. citizen, you will need
to ask an accountant or other tax professional
for the answer to this question, and how it
might apply to you in your location.
Please note that we are not accountants and
are not qualified to provide accounting, tax,
or other legal advice. Our answer is based
on our understanding of the tax rules, and
how we handle this situation ourselves. Always
check with your accountant or other tax professional.
